    Abstract: Provided are a voice denoising method and apparatus, a server and a storage medium. The voice denoising method comprises: acquiring voice signals synchronously collected by an acoustic microphone and a non-acoustic microphone (S100); carrying out voice activity detection according to the voice signal collected by the non-acoustic microphone to obtain a voice activity detection result (S110); and according to the voice activity detection result, denoising the voice signal collected by the acoustic microphone to obtain a denoised voice signal (S120). The effect of denoising can be enhanced, and the quality of voice signals can be improved.

    Abstract: Provided is a gas switch triggered by an optical pulse introduced by an optical fiber, which solves the problem of the existing electrically-triggered gas switch and laser-triggered gas having a complicated trigger system, being insufficiently reliable and having a higher cost due to the pulse amplitude/laser beam energy having higher requirements. The gas switch triggered by an optical pulse introduced by an optical fiber includes at least one trigger gap and one self-breakdown gap; each trigger gap is connected in parallel to a photoconductive switch, and an optical fiber is correspondingly provided for introducing an optical pulse for triggering.

    Abstract: Techniques for searching documents are described. An exemplary method includes receiving a document search query; querying at least one index based upon the document search query to identify matching data; fetching the identified matched data; determining one or more of a top ranked passage and top ranked documents from the set of documents based upon one or more invocations of one or more machine learning models based at least on the fetched identified matched data and the document search query; and returning one or more of the top ranked passage and the proper subset of documents.

    Abstract: Techniques for generation of synthetic queries from customer data for training of document querying machine learning (ML) models as a service are described. A service may receive one or more documents from a user, generate a set of question and answer pairs from the one or more documents from the user using a machine learning model trained to predict a question from an answer, and store the set of question and answer pairs generated from the one or more documents from the user. The question and answer pairs may be used to train another machine learning model, for example, a document ranking model, a passage ranking model, a question/answer model, or a frequently asked question (FAQ) model.

    Abstract: The disclosure discloses an apparatus and a method for microbial cell counting, and belongs to the field of cell counting. In the present application, by converting a traditional automated intermittent counting process into a continuous counting process, the cell sap fixed in a blood cell plate in a traditional counter becomes the cell sap flowing in a microchannel, so as to prolong the cell detection time and distance. The size of the microchannel is slightly greater than the diameter of microbial cells, so as to ensure that the cells flow through the cross section of the microchannel one by one. At the same time, since the diameter of the counterbores communicated by the microchannel is slightly greater than the width of the microchannel, the flow rate of the cell sap slows down when the cell sap flows to the counterbores.

    Abstract: An echo cancellation method based on delay estimation is provided. In the method, a microphone signal and a reference signal are received and preprocessed. In the preprocessed microphone signal and the preprocessed reference signal, frequency point signals with non-linearity in a current echo cancellation scenario are determined. A current delay estimation value is calculated based on frequency point signals without non-linearity in the microphone signal and the reference signal. The reference signal is shifted based on the current delay estimation value. An adaptive filter is updated based on the preprocessed microphone signal and the shifted reference signal, to perform echo cancellation.

    Abstract: A semantic parsing method using a graph-to-sequence model, system, and computer program product include generating a syntactic graph for a sentence, generating node embeddings for each node based on other nodes the each node is connected to in the syntactic graph, generating a graph embedding over the node embeddings, performing attention-based recurrent neural network (RNN) decoding of the graph embedding and the node embeddings, and providing a logical translation of the sentence based on the decoding.

    Abstract: A microphone array-based target voice acquisition method and device, said method comprising: receiving voice signals acquired on the basis of a microphone array (101); determining a pre-selected target voice signal and a direction thereof (102); performing strong directional gain and weak directional gain on the pre-selected target voice signal, so as to obtain a strong gain signal and a weak gain signal (103); performing an endpoint detection on the basis of the strong gain signal, so as to obtain an endpoint detection result (104); and performing endpoint processing on the weak gain signal according to the endpoint detection result, so as to obtain a final target voice signal (105). The present invention can obtain an accurate and reliable target voice signal, thereby avoiding an adverse effect of the target voice quality on subsequent target voice processing.

    Abstract: A target voice detection method and a target voice detection apparatus are provided. The method includes: receiving sound signals collected by a microphone array; performing a beamforming process on the sound signals to obtain beams in different directions; extracting a detection feature of each frame based on the sound signals and the beams in different directions; inputting an extracted detection feature of a current frame into a pre-constructed target voice detection model to obtain a model output result; and obtaining a target voice detection result of the current frame based on the model output result.

    Abstract: A method (and structure and computer product) of machine translation for processing input questions includes receiving, in a processor on a computer, an input question presented in a natural language. The input question is preprocessed to find one or more condition values for possible Structured Query Language (SQL) queries. One or more possible SQL queries are enumerated based on the one or more found condition values and a paraphrasing model is used to rank the enumerated SQL queries. The highest ranked SQL query is executed against a relational database to search for a response to the input question.

    Abstract: The present invention discloses a model-free online recursive optimization method for a batch process based on variable period decomposition. Variable operation data closely related to product quality is acquired, optimization action on each subset is integrated on the basis of time domain variable division on the process by utilizing a data driving method and a global optimization strategy is formed, based on which an online recursive error correction optimization strategy is implemented. According to the method, the online optimization strategy is formed completely based on the operation data of the batch process without needing prior knowledge or a model of a process mechanism. Meanwhile, the optimized operation locus line has better adaptability by using the online recursive correction strategy, and thus the anti-interference requirement of the actual industrial production is better met.

    Abstract: A method, an apparatus and a device for converting a whispered speech, and a readable storage medium are provided. The method is implemented based on the whispered speech converting model. The whispered speech converting model is trained in advance by using recognition results and whispered speech training acoustic features of whispered speech training data as samples and using normal speech acoustic features of normal speech data parallel to the whispered speech training data as sample labels. A whispered speech acoustic feature and a preliminary recognition result of whispered speech data are acquired, then the whispered speech acoustic feature and the preliminary recognition result are inputted into a preset whispered speech converting model to acquire a normal speech acoustic feature outputted by the model. In this way, the whispered speech can be converted to a normal speech.
